Table of contents
在本教程中,我将与你分享 6 简单的方法来 合并多个细胞 你可以在任何数据集中轻松地应用这些方法,用逗号将许多单元格的值连接到一个单元格内。 为了实现这一任务,我们还将看到一些有用的功能,这些功能在许多其他与Excel有关的任务中可能会很方便。
下载实践工作手册
你可以从这里下载实践工作手册。
在Excel中把多个单元格合并成一个由逗号分隔的单元格的6种简单方法
我们采取了一个简明的数据集来清楚地解释步骤。 该数据集约有 7 行和 4 最初,我们将所有单元格保持在 一般 对于所有的数据集,我们有 4 的唯一列,这些列是 公司,产品1,产品2。 和 合并的 尽管如果需要的话,我们以后可以改变列的数量。
1.使用Ampersand操作符来合并多个单元格
在这第一个方法中,我们将看到如何使用 安倍晋三 运营商在 ǞǞǞ 至 合并多个细胞 请按照以下步骤进行操作。
步骤。
- 首先,转到单元格 E5 并插入以下公式。
=C5&", "&D5
- 现在,按 进入 并将此公式复制到其他单元格。
因此,这应该会给我们带来我们所寻找的结果。
2.通过CONCATENATE函数将多个单元格合并为一个单元格
CONCATENATE函数 我们将使用这个函数来处理以下问题 合并多个细胞 变成一个由逗号分隔的。
步骤。
- 首先,双击单元格 E5 并输入以下公式。
=concatenate(c5,", ",d5)
- 接下来,按 进入 键,并复制下面的公式,使用 填充手柄 .
正如你所看到的,上述方法对于快速组合带有逗号的单元格也是非常方便的。
3.应用CONCAT函数
CONCAT函数 在Excel中,这个函数的工作原理与前一个函数类似,但它除了接受单个数值外,还可以接受范围参考。 让我们看看如何使用这个函数来 合并多个细胞 变成一个由逗号分隔的。
步骤。
- 如前所述,在单元格中插入以下公式 E5 :
=concat(c5,",",d5)
- 之后,按 进入 键或点击任何空白单元格。
- 最后,在列的其他单元格中使用这个公式 E .
结果是,你应该得到你想要的结果。
4.利用TEXTJOIN功能
TEXTJOIN函数 下面是使用这个函数的步骤,它可以连接多个数值并在它们之间添加分隔符。 合并多个细胞 变成一个由逗号分隔的。
步骤。
- 首先,转到单元格 E5 并插入以下公式。
=textjoin(", ",1,c5,d5)
- 之后,按以下步骤确认该公式 进入 并通过拖动该公式向下复制。 填充手柄 .
因此,在 文本编辑器(TEXTJOIN 功能 也是非常有用的,可以将多个单元格合并为一个。
5.使用Excel闪存填充功能将多个单元格用逗号组合起来
现在让我们看看一个快速的方法来 合并多个细胞 变成一个用逗号分隔的 闪光填充 在Excel中的功能。
步骤。
- 首先,输入单元格的值 C5 和 D5 之间使用逗号,在单元格 E5 .
- 现在,选择所有单元格,从 E5 至 E10 .
- 然后,点击 闪光填充 根据 数据工具 组的 数据标签 在屏幕的顶部。
- 因此, 闪光填充 该功能将识别细胞的模式 E5 并将其也应用于其他细胞。
6.使用VBA来合并多个单元格
如果你熟悉 VBA 在Excel中,那么你可以很容易地 合并多个细胞 请按照以下步骤进行操作。
步骤。
- 对于这种方法,请到 开发商 选项卡,并选择 视觉基础 .
- 现在,选择 插入 在 VBA 窗口,并点击 模块 .
- 接下来,在新窗口中键入以下公式。
Function CombineCells(WorkingRange As Range, Optional Sign As String = ", ") As String Dim Sh_Rng As Range Dim ResultStr As String For Each Sh_Rng In WorkingRange If Sh_Rng.Value " " Then ResultStr = ResultStr & Sh_Rng.Value & Sign End If Next CombineCells = Left(ResultStr, Len(ResultStr) - Len(Sign)) End Function
- 现在,请转到单元格 E5 并插入以下公式。
=Combine(C5:D5,",")
- 然后,按 进入 键,并使用 填充手柄 在其他细胞中也做同样的操作。
总结
我希望你能够应用我在本教程中所展示的方法,即如何 合并多个细胞 正如你所看到的,有相当多的方法来实现这一点。 因此,明智地选择最适合你的情况的方法。 如果你在任何一个步骤中被卡住,我建议多看几遍,以消除任何困惑。 最后,要了解更多信息 ǞǞǞ 技术,遵循我们的 ǞǞǞ 如果你有任何疑问,请在评论中告诉我。